“Dubbed the “Light Car,” the concept car is designed to communicate with other drivers using a system of OLED lights, which rest on the some part of the body of the car including the front and rear light, in the form of an OLED display panel. The use of OLEDs not only saves energy, but also enables the driver to change their shape and design at will. The car is powered by an all electric drive train that provides enough power for a 150 km ride on every charge. To get the most out of the batteries, the body of the car has been made from basalt fiber that is both lightweight and 100% recyclable.”
